No plan to set up diesel plant in India: Hyundai MD

Reversing his predecessor's decision to set up a diesel engine facility in Chennai, Hyundai

Motor India's new Managing Director and CEO Han-Woo Park today said as of now there was no such plan.

"As of today, I do not consider a diesel plant, I do not have any idea. If the diesel market expands, then we will consider," he told reporters here.

However, launching the diesel version of hatchback i20 in July this year, Park's predecessor Heung Soo Lheem had said: "Currently we are importing diesel engine from Korea. The production (from) the diesel plant in Chennai will start by the end of 2010."

The new MD added that the company is currently carrying out a feasibility study for the plant, but remained non- committal on setting up the facility.

"We are doing feasibility study for a diesel plant. But we need some volume for the diesel plant, without volume we cannot have an engine (diesel) plant. It will need huge cost. If we reach some diesel volume in India, then we can consider the plant... Nothing is happening now," he said.

On shifting production of its latest offering i20 to Europe for exporting to the region, HMIL Senior Vice-President (Marketing and Sales) Arvind Saxena said manufacturing of the car would start in Turkey in the second half of 2010.
